>>42029306
No you just improvise with whats avaible. If I cant do flat bench because its all taken, I take a bench and do dumbell flat bench, if all that is taken I do weighted dips. If nothing gets avaible at all just ask a guy how many sets he has left or if hes doing similar weight if you can work in.
Basically if youre not a total sperg there is no problem
